This role focuses on developing and maintaining systems that define standards and increase productivity through effective management of people, facilities, and technology. The Industrial Engineer will tackle organizational and operational challenges, apply Six Sigma methodologies to reduce waste and improve quality, and support cost‑reduction initiatives while ensuring on time delivery and high customer satisfaction.

  • Develop and maintain productivity standards through data‑driven analysis of people, processes, facilities, and technology.
  • Analyze organizational and operational challenges, proposing innovative and practical solutions.
  • Apply Six Sigma tools and methodologies to reduce waste, improve quality, and drive continuous improvement across operations.
  • Support cost‑reduction initiatives while ensuring orders and finished goods meet quality, timing, and customer requirements.
  • Review Requests for Proposals (RFPs) and prepare labor cost estimates, solution responses, presentations, and deployment plans for awarded opportunities.
  • Evaluate facility space and capacity against current and forecasted volumes, determining utilization rates and recommending footprint adjustments.
  • Assess workflows and capital resources to identify the most effective methods for meeting customer requirements.
  • Analyze production techniques, staffing models, and equipment usage to determine production rates and operational capacity.
  • Plan and design systems that improve productivity through better integration of people, materials, and equipment.
  • Recommend enhancements to work methods, safety practices, and labor organization.
  • Develop labor standards through analysis of work samples, workflows, production methods, and operator techniques.
  • Apply ergonomic principles to workstation and work method design to reduce fatigue and prevent work‑related injuries.
  • Review and optimize facility layouts to improve efficiency, throughput, and product quality.
